WebApr 13, 2024 · Express Scripts’ new Copay Assurance™ plan ensures consumers pay less out-of-pocket by capping copays on prescription drugs at $5 for generics, $25 for preferred brand drugs, and $45 for preferred specialty brand drugs. “A prescription drug doesn’t work if it’s priced out of reach. Your copayment for a … now gg racingWebA copay cap is the highest dollar amount that members can be charged in pharmacy copays in a month. MassHealth calculates a monthly copay cap for each member based on the lowest income in their household and their household size. MassHealth rounds the copay cap down to the nearest $10 amount.
